




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、超市信息管理系统详细设计说明书小组成员:彭胜王紫云 杨雪 肖明 蔺亚晴 赵倩1 引言1.1 编写目的根据 需求规格说明书、 概要设计说明书, 在仔细考虑讨论之后,我对 超市理货系统商品进货及主要界面子系统软件的功能划分、数据结构、软件总体结构的实现有了进一步的想法。我们将这些想法记录下来,作为详细设计说明书,为进一步设计软件、编写代码打下基础。在前一阶段(概要设计说明书)中, 已解决了实现该系统需求的程序模块设计问题。 包括如何把该系统划分成若干个模块、决定各个模块之间的接口、模块之间传递的信息,以及数据结构、模块结构的设计等。在以下的详细设计报告中将对在本阶段中对系统所做的所有详细设计进行说
2、明。在本阶段中,确定应该如何具体地实现所要求的系统,从而在编码阶段可以把这个描述直接翻译成用具体的程序语言书写的程序。主要的工作有:根据在需求分析说明书中所描述的数据、功能、运行、性能需求,并依照概要设计说明书 所确定的处理流程、总体结构和模块外部设计,设计软件系统的结构设计、逐个模块的程序描述(包括各模块的功能、性能、 输入、 输出、 算法、 程序逻辑、接口等等)1.2 背景a. 待开发系统:超市理货系统商品进货及主要界面子系统b. 项目任务提出者:小型超市管理人员c. 开发者:河北软件职业技术学院软件工程学院09嵌入式第一小组d. 最终用户:小型超市各收银员e. 小型超市零售管理系统是小型
3、超市商品销售及货物管理的主要控制部分,直接影响销售的方便性及管理的规范性。随着信息时代的发展,对效率的要求日益提高,因而软件控制销售和管理已经取代了传统全手工方式。小型超市具有自身的特点:商品要求一般齐全,进出货关系较为简单,员工人数种类不多;在软件角度看,数据较少,对存储和速度要求不高。但正由于员工较少,使用软件控制成为必须。1.3 定义无1.4 参考资料1 «Database System Concepts(Fourth Edition) Abraham Silberschatz Henry F.Korth S.Sudarshan Higher Education Press2王
4、珊.数据库系统概论(第四版).高等教育出版社,2007.3罗运模.完全掌握SQL Server 2000人民邮电出版社,2001.4白尚旺等.PowerDesigner软件工程技术.电子工业出版社,2004.5张海藩.软件工程概论(第五版).清华大学出版社,2007.6赵松涛.Visual Basic+SQL Server 2000系统开发实录.电子工业出版社, 2007.7陈燕峰等.Visual Basic数据库项目案例导航.清华大学出版社,2004.8需求规格说明书9概要设计说明书2系统的结构图5-1超市管理系统功能结构图3数据库模块设计说明E-R 图:商品名称销售价格N销售ID打折信息销
5、售销售日期条形码1销售数目管理员11进货ID进货名称商品名称条形码进货商N商品价格供应商进货数库存数制造商进货日期供应商制造商条形码进货日期状态/进货N图5-2数据库模块设计说明4 .系统登录模块功能:本模块的主要功能是对用户身份进行,验证只有系统的合法用户才 能进入系统。其窗体如图5-3所示:图5-3系统登录模块在进行系统登录过程中,登录模块将调用数据库里的用户清单,并对账号和 密码进行验证,只有输入了正确的账号和密码后, 系统登录才会成功。在登录模 块中,对系统的尝试登录次数进行了限制,禁止用户无终止的进行系统登录尝试, 在本系统中,当用户对系统的三次登录失败后,系统将自动机制登录,突出登
6、录模块。并在输入了错误的或者是不存在的账户和密码时, 系统会给出出错信息提 示,指明登录过程中的错误输入或者错误操作,以便用户进行正确的登录。输入项、输出项:输入项为账号和密码。账号和密码均为字符串,长度各为 6个字符,密码回显字符是5 .进货管理模块功能:该模块主要是实现进行进货信息查询、进货计划制定两个功能。进货信息查询:该模块为超市提供整个超市的进货情况查询, 也可以进行进货信息的明细查询,并以进货报表形式打印出来。进货计划制定:该模块可以为制定进货计划,并形成相应的采购订单。输入项、输出项:该模块的输入项为超市的进货单,其中包括进货单的编号 商品的编号,供货商号,进货价,数量,金额进货
7、日期,备注。(1)该进货管理模块的用例图,如图 5-4所示:图5-4进货管理用例图该进货管理模块的活动图,如图 5-5所示:图5-5进货管理模块活动图4 -(3)制定进货计划的时序图,如图5-6所示:管理员进货计划制定界面确认进货清单输入管理账号iII进货计划更新信息i1图5-6制定进货计划时序图进货信息查询时序图,如图5-7所示:6 -图5-7进货信息查询时序图6.销售管理模块功能:本模块的主要功能是把销售信息写入销售清单, 同时对库存清单进行 更新,以备用户将来对库存信息进行查询和打印, 此外还可以对销售信息进行查 询和盘点功能。销售信息查询:根据商品销售情况,按需要对销售情况进行查询。在
8、该查询 模块中,可以按照商品的编号、销售日期等多种方式进行商品销售信息查询。销售信息盘点:可以按照需要对在一定时期内的销售情况进行盘点。输入项、输出项:本模块的数据输入项主要是商品的销售单号和商品编号。 其中还包括销售数量和销售日期。该销售模块的用例图,如图5-8所示:图5-8销售管理模块用例图该销售管理模块的活动图,如图 5-9所示:图5-9销售管理模块活动图7 -销售信息查询时序图,如图5-10所示:系统管理员输入商品信息界面查询商品+销售清单输入商品基本信息 确认商品信息查询商品信息查询操作结果图5-10销售信息查询时序图销售盘点时序图,如图5-11所示:图5-11销售盘点时序图8 -7
9、库存管理模块功能:本模块的主要功能是商品信息的查询和更新,库存信息的查询和更新。查询商品信息:主要功能查询商品的明细信息,和它的库存信息。添加商品信息:主要功能添加新进的商品。修改商品信息:主要功能是修改商品的信息,包括他的库存数量。删除商品信息:主要功能是删除不再销售的商品信息。输入项、输出项:本模块的数据输入项主要是商品编号。(1)该库存管理模块的用例图,如图 5-12所示:库存管理模块活动图,如图5-13所示:图5-13库存管理模块活动图10 -(3)库存管理查询时序图,如图5-14所示:11 -图5-14库存管理查询时序图(4)库存管理添加时序图,如图5-15所示:图5-15库存管理添
10、加时序图(5)库存管理修改时序图,如图5-16所示:-13图5-16商品管理修改时序图(6)库存管理删除时序图,如图5-17所示:图5-17库存管理删除时序图8职工管理模块在系统开发中,为解决超市人员流动问题,在系统中增添了员工管理子模块,用来对超市的人员进行信息化管理, 以此来提高员工的办事效率,节约人力 资源。新员工录入:在超市招进新员工时,对其进行基本信息的存储,对员工信息 进行基本的了解。员工信息维护:当员工信息发生变化,或者是员工离职,换岗对相关信息发 生变化时,利用此子模块对其进行信息变更。(1)职工管理模块用例图,如图5-18所示:图5-18职工信息管理模块用例图14 -职工管理
11、模块活动图,如图5-19所示:- 16v输入职工信息确认职工信息查询欲修改的信息输入欲删除的职工信息输入新的职工信息确认删除信息保存确认信息、| (从数据库表中删除职工信息保存职工信息图5-19职工管理模块活动图(3)职工管理查询时序图,如图5-20所示:管理员职工管理界面11 i11111输入管理帐号1 1i1 ii1 1X确认职工清单职工查询信息职工信息查询操作结果图5-20职工管理查询时序图添加新职工时序图,如图5-21所示:-18管理员输入职工信息添加职工清单输入新职工基本信息确认新职工基本信息保存新职工基本信息 添加操作结果图5-21新职工添加时序图(5)职工信息修改时序图,如图5-
12、22所示:管理员输入信息界面修改职工清单确认职工信息?!修改操作结果输入欲修改的职工信息保存职工信息 图5-22职工信息修改时序图(6)职工信息删除时序图,如图5-23所示:管理员输入信息界面删除职工清单- 21输入欲删除的职工信息 确认职工信息删除职工信息删除操作结果图5-23职工信息删除时序图9供货商信息管理模块在超市引进商品时,首先查询已有的供货商信息,然后按照供货商信息采购 商品;或者从新的供货商那里引进新的商品, 此时,要把新供货商信息添加到供 货商清单中。有时,不再从某一供货商那里采购商品时, 此时要把供货商信息删 掉。当供货商信息有变化时,就需要对供货商信息进行维护等。(1)供货
13、商信息管理模块用例图,如图 5-24所示:(2)供货商信息管理模块活动图,如图 5-25所示:iL.(供货商管理图5-25供货商信息管理活动图供货商信息管理查询时序图,如图 5-26所示:管理员供货商管理界面111111!1j输入管理帐号11 1111 iy确认供货商清单-22供货商查询信息查询供货商信息查询操作结果图5-26供货商信息管理查询时序图供货商信息管理删除时序图,如图5-27所示:管理员输入信息界面删除供货商清单输入欲删除的供货商信息9确认供货商信息删除供货商信息删除操作结果图5-27供货商信息管理删除时序图管理员输入供货商信息添加供货商清单输入新供货商基本信息确认新供货商基本信息i保存新供货商基本信息- 24添加操作结果图5
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025-2030年中国数码经络治疗仪行业发展机遇与投资方向预测研究报告
- 留守儿童与义务教育论文
- 湖北省“黄鄂鄂”2025年高三下学期4月联考试题 生物 含答案
- 兽医病理解剖试题含答案
- 池州市重点中学2025年高考英语二模试卷含答案
- 辽宁省锦州市第四中学2025届高三一诊考试英语试卷含解析
- 职业技术学院护理五年制专业人才培养方案
- 2025年吉林省长春市中考二模历史试题(原卷版+解析版)
- 河南省名校大联考2024-2025学年高一下学期4月期中数学试题(原卷版+解析版)
- 糖果与巧克力食品安全与质量控制方法实践案例分析实践案例考核试卷
- 乳腺癌化疗个案护理
- 眼睛的结构和视觉系统
- 陕09J01 建筑用料及做法图集
- 2024年医疗信息安全培训资料
- 心电监护技术
- 餐厅销售技巧培训
- 电机与电气控制技术课程说课
- 国开《Windows网络操作系统管理》形考任务2-配置本地帐户与活动目录域服务实训
- GA/T 2087-2023法庭科学玻璃破碎痕迹检验技术规程
- XX医院高警示药品(高危药品)目录
- 锁边机安全操作规程
评论
0/150
提交评论